Driveway installation services involve the process of designing and constructing a durable, functional surface that provides access to a property’s garage, parking area, or entrance. These services typically include site preparation, such as clearing and leveling the ground, followed by laying down materials like asphalt, concrete, or paving stones. Skilled contractors ensure the driveway is properly graded to facilitate drainage and prevent water pooling, which can lead to damage over time. The goal is to create a smooth, long-lasting surface that enhances the property's curb appeal and provides a safe, reliable space for vehicles.
Many homeowners turn to driveway installation to solve common issues like uneven or cracked surfaces, which can pose safety hazards or cause damage to vehicles. A poorly maintained or damaged driveway can also detract from the overall appearance of a property and reduce its value. New driveway installation can address these problems by replacing old, deteriorated surfaces with a fresh, sturdy layer that withstands the demands of daily use. Additionally, a well-constructed driveway can help prevent water runoff issues and reduce the risk of flooding around the property’s foundation.

The overview below groups typical Driveway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Horry County, SC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way repairs or patching in Horry County range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ials used.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this band.
Resurfacing or Overlay - Resurfacing a driveway with a new layer of asphalt or concrete generally costs between $1,000-$3,000. Most projects in this category are mid-sized and stay within this range, though larger or more complex overlays can cost more.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ire driveway can typically cost from $4,000-$8,000, with larger or more intricate designs reaching $10,000 or more. Many standard replacements fall into the middle of this range, while very large or detailed projects push into higher tiers.
Custom or Decorative Driveways - Custom designs, stamped concrete, or decorative finishes often start around $5,000 and can go beyond $15,000 for elaborate work. Such projects are less common and tend to be on the higher end of the cost sp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
